B777-200 Type Rating Course

1. Introduction

IFA offer two types of Type Rating Courses:
- Transition Course - for pilots with pre-requirements defined by JAR-FCL 1.261 for the Type Rating Training Qualification

- Shortness Course - it is a transition course with less training and simulator hours for pilots with the certification in Boeing 757/767 or  Boeing 737(300-900),  or other Boeing aircraft , accepted by the authority. Pilots also have to confirm their recent experience in the aircrafts mentioned above.

2. Course Prerequisites

 2.1 Transition Course

  • Hold a Commercial pilot licence with a ATPL Frozen, Multi-Engine, Instrument Rating and MCC (Multi-Crew Cooperation)
OR
  • Holds an Airline Transport Pilot licence ATPL and meet additional aircraft category and class ratings, as appropriate.

 2.2 Shortness Course

  • Hold an Airline Transport Pilot Certificate and be qualified in Aircrafts Boeing B 757/767 or Boeing 737/300-900.

3. Course Objectives

IFA’s B-777-200 Aircraft Initial Ground Training objective is to provide flight crewmembers with the necessary knowledge for understanding the basic functions of aircraft systems, the use of the individual system components, the integration of aircraft systems and operational procedures. Trainees must successfully complete the applicable B-777-200 Ground Training curriculum segments, before proceeding to the Flight Training curriculum segments.

4. Course Structure

Transition Course:

 A) Theoretical Instruction – 105h
   Modules:
  • Aircraft Systems training
  • General Operations subjects
  • Review and Examination
  • Procedures training
  • Preflight inspection

B) Simulator Training
   Modules:

  • FBS – 10PF + 10PM
  • FFS - 16PF + 16PM
  • Flight Training and Test – 2PF + 2PM

Shortness Course:

 A) Theoretical Instruction – 59h
   Modules:
  • Aircraft Systems training
  • General Operations subjects
  • Review and Examination
  • Procedures training
  • Preflight inspection

 B) Simulator Training
   Modules:

  • FBS – 06PF + 06PM
  • FFS - 10PF + 10PM
  • Flight Training and Test – 2PF + 2PM
